Skip to content
Join our Newsletter

Report a Typo or Mistake

Optional

Optional

Optional

Would you like a cicada salad? The monstrous little noisemakers descend on a New Orleans menu
https://www.timescolonist.com/the-mix/would-you-like-a-cicada-salad-the-monstrous-little-noisemakers-descend-on-a-new-orleans-menu-8623464
Verify